I know that life can be overwhelming

Sometimes what we need more than anything is a place to unload and get some fresh perspective. Therapy can be the place to gain a deeper understanding of our selves, our values, and to get the needed push (read: a kick in the ass) to try something different.

  • Founder, Owner

    I am a licensed Marriage and Family Therapist in practice since 2009. I received my Masters degree in Marriage and Family Therapy from Loma Linda University in Southern California. I started my private practice because I was looking for more. After thirteen years working in community mental health, I wanted to do more than worksheets and manualized care. Having my own practice also allows me to have better work life balance. Outside of my practice, I enjoy reading, traveling with my dog, eating good food, and drinking good wine.
